Vanessa Meikle Schulman, an art historian in the Department of History and Art History, has received a grant to support the publication of her new book.  The book, Art During Wartime: Painting Everyday Life in the Civil War North, is forthcoming with University of Massachusetts Press in 2024.  The grant is from the New Foundation for Art History, whose goal is to promote the diversity of the field of art history.
